php数据库是什么意思啊
-
PHP数据库是指在PHP编程语言中使用的数据库。数据库是用于存储和管理数据的系统。PHP是一种服务器端脚本语言,常用于Web开发。在PHP中,可以使用多种数据库系统来存储和操作数据,如MySQL、SQLite、PostgreSQL等。PHP提供了一系列的数据库函数和扩展,使开发者能够连接和操作数据库。通过PHP数据库,开发者可以进行数据的增删改查操作,实现数据的持久化存储,并与Web应用程序进行交互。以下是关于PHP数据库的一些重要概念和功能:
-
数据库连接:PHP提供了连接数据库的函数和扩展,可以连接各种类型的数据库系统。通过建立数据库连接,PHP可以与数据库服务器进行通信,进行数据的读写操作。
-
数据库查询:PHP可以通过SQL语句向数据库发送查询请求,获取所需的数据。开发者可以使用PHP的数据库函数和扩展执行各种类型的查询操作,如SELECT、INSERT、UPDATE、DELETE等。
-
数据库事务:PHP数据库支持事务的概念,开发者可以使用事务来确保一组数据库操作的原子性。通过使用事务,可以在一组相关的操作中保持数据的一致性和完整性。
-
数据库安全性:PHP数据库提供了一些安全机制,帮助开发者防止数据库攻击。开发者可以使用参数化查询或准备语句等方法,防止SQL注入等安全问题。
-
数据库扩展:PHP提供了丰富的数据库扩展,可以与不同类型的数据库系统进行交互。开发者可以根据项目需求选择适合的数据库扩展,如mysqli、PDO等,来连接和操作数据库。
总之,PHP数据库是指在PHP编程语言中使用的数据库系统。通过PHP数据库,开发者可以连接和操作数据库,实现数据的持久化存储和交互。
1年前 -
-
PHP数据库是指使用PHP语言进行数据库操作的一种技术。数据库是用来存储和管理数据的软件,而PHP是一种广泛应用于网站开发的脚本语言。PHP数据库技术就是利用PHP语言来连接、操作和管理数据库。
在网站开发中,经常需要与数据库进行交互,包括存储用户信息、读取文章内容、更新商品数据等等。PHP提供了一系列的函数和扩展来方便地进行数据库操作。PHP支持多种数据库,常用的有MySQL、SQLite、PostgreSQL等。
PHP数据库技术主要包括以下几个方面:
-
连接数据库:使用PHP可以通过指定数据库的地址、用户名、密码等信息来连接数据库,建立与数据库的通信。
-
执行SQL语句:一旦与数据库连接成功,就可以通过PHP执行SQL语句,包括查询数据、插入数据、更新数据、删除数据等操作。
-
处理查询结果:PHP可以将查询结果以数组、对象等形式返回,方便对数据进行处理和展示。
-
数据库安全:PHP提供了一些函数和技术来防止数据库注入等安全问题,保障数据的安全性。
PHP数据库技术的应用非常广泛,几乎所有的网站都需要与数据库进行交互。通过PHP数据库技术,可以方便地实现网站的数据存储、数据展示、数据更新等功能,为网站的开发和维护提供了强大的支持。
1年前 -
-
PHP数据库是指使用PHP语言进行数据库操作的技术。数据库是用来存储和管理大量结构化数据的系统,而PHP是一种广泛用于网页开发的脚本语言。PHP数据库技术使得开发人员可以使用PHP语言与数据库进行交互,实现数据的增删改查等操作。
在PHP中,常用的数据库包括MySQL、SQLite、PostgreSQL等。这些数据库都提供了相应的PHP扩展,开发人员可以通过PHP扩展来连接数据库、执行SQL语句、处理查询结果等。
下面将从方法、操作流程等方面介绍如何使用PHP进行数据库操作。
一、连接数据库
要使用PHP操作数据库,首先需要连接到数据库。连接数据库的步骤如下:- 使用PHP提供的相应扩展函数,比如mysqli_connect()或PDO的构造函数来创建数据库连接。
- 提供数据库的主机名、用户名、密码以及数据库名等参数。
- 执行连接操作,并获取连接对象或连接资源。
二、执行SQL语句
连接到数据库之后,可以执行SQL语句对数据库进行操作。SQL语句可以是查询语句(SELECT),也可以是更新语句(INSERT、UPDATE、DELETE)等。-
查询语句:使用SELECT语句从数据库中获取数据。通过执行查询语句,可以获取满足条件的数据记录。
- 使用mysqli_query()函数或PDO的prepare()和execute()方法执行查询语句。
- 使用mysqli_fetch_array()、mysqli_fetch_assoc()等函数或PDO的fetch()方法获取查询结果。
-
更新语句:使用INSERT、UPDATE、DELETE等语句对数据库中的数据进行增删改操作。
- 使用mysqli_query()函数或PDO的prepare()和execute()方法执行更新语句。
- 使用mysqli_affected_rows()函数或PDO的rowCount()方法获取受影响的行数。
三、处理查询结果
执行查询语句后,可以通过相应的函数或方法获取查询结果,并进行处理。-
对于SELECT语句,可以使用mysqli_fetch_array()、mysqli_fetch_assoc()等函数或PDO的fetch()方法获取查询结果。
- mysqli_fetch_array()函数返回一个索引数组和关联数组,可以根据列名或索引访问查询结果。
- mysqli_fetch_assoc()函数返回一个关联数组,可以根据列名访问查询结果。
- PDO的fetch()方法根据设置的获取模式,返回关联数组、索引数组或自定义类的对象。
-
处理查询结果时,可以对结果进行遍历、筛选、排序等操作,以满足具体需求。
四、关闭数据库连接
在使用完数据库之后,应该关闭数据库连接,以释放资源和避免连接数过多导致性能下降。- 使用mysqli_close()函数或PDO的nullify()方法关闭数据库连接。
总结:
PHP数据库技术使得开发人员可以使用PHP语言与数据库进行交互,实现数据的增删改查等操作。连接数据库、执行SQL语句、处理查询结果和关闭数据库连接是PHP数据库操作的基本流程。通过掌握这些基本操作,开发人员可以利用PHP与数据库进行数据交互,实现各种网站和应用程序的功能。1年前